ນີ້ແມ່ນຄໍາສັ່ງ xwit ທີ່ສາມາດດໍາເນີນການໄດ້ໃນ OnWorks ຜູ້ໃຫ້ບໍລິການໂຮດຕິ້ງຟຣີໂດຍໃຊ້ຫນຶ່ງໃນຫຼາຍໆບ່ອນເຮັດວຽກອອນໄລນ໌ຂອງພວກເຮົາເຊັ່ນ Ubuntu Online, Fedora Online, Windows online emulator ຫຼື MAC OS online emulator
ໂຄງການ:
NAME
xwit - window interface tool: pop or iconify this xterm window or named windows
ສະຫຼຸບສັງລວມ
xwit [- ຈໍສະແດງຜົນ ການສະແດງ] [- ຊິ້ງ] [-ປ໊ອບ] [- ສຸມໃສ່ການ] [-iconify] [- unmap]
[- ຍົກສູງຂຶ້ນ] [- ຕ່ໍາກວ່າ] [- ກົງກັນຂ້າມ] [-[un]ໝຸນ ວຽນ]
[-ຂະຫນາດ w h] [- ແຖວ r] [- ຖັນ c] [-[r]ການເຄື່ອນໄຫວ x y]
[-[r]warp x y] [- ແຜນທີ່ສີ colormapid] [-[no]save]
[-yam ຊື່] [-ຊື່ໄອຄອນ ຊື່]
[- ແຜນທີ່ບິດ ເອກະສານ] [-ຫນ້າກາກ ເອກະສານ] [-[r]ໄອຄອນຍ້າຍ x y]
[-[no]backingstore] [-[no]ປະຢັດເງິນ]
[-[no]ຊ້ຳຄືນ ລະຫັດ ... ລະຫັດ - ລະຫັດ ...]
[-id windowid] [- ຮາກ] [- ປະຈຸບັນ] [- ເລືອກ] [-ທັງຫມົດ] [- ຊື່ ສາຍຍ່ອຍເບື້ອງຕົ້ນ...]
ລາຍລະອຽດ
xwit ເປັນເຄື່ອງມືການໂຕ້ຕອບປ່ອງຢ້ຽມ X. ໂດຍຄ່າເລີ່ມຕົ້ນເມື່ອຖືກນໍາໃຊ້ໂດຍບໍ່ມີການໂຕ້ຖຽງໃນ xterm ມັນ
de-iconifies ແລະຍົກສູງບົດບາດປ່ອງຢ້ຽມ. ທ່ານສາມາດກໍານົດຫນ້າທີ່ທີ່ແຕກຕ່າງກັນທີ່ຈະເຮັດ, ເຊັ່ນ:
iconifying ປ່ອງຢ້ຽມ, ແລະນໍາໃຊ້ມັນກັບປ່ອງຢ້ຽມຫຼາຍທີ່ມີຊື່ເລີ່ມຕົ້ນດ້ວຍຫນຶ່ງໃນ
ສະຕຣິງທີ່ໃຫ້, ຫຼື id window ສະເພາະທີ່ໃຫ້, ຫຼື id window ທີ່ພົບເຫັນຢູ່ໃນສະພາບແວດລ້ອມ
ຕົວແປ ປ່ອງຢ້ຽມ (ເຊິ່ງຖືກກໍານົດໂດຍ xterm ສໍາລັບໂຄງການທີ່ມັນແລ່ນ), ຫຼືປ່ອງຢ້ຽມພາຍໃຕ້
ຕົວກະພິບເມົ້າ.
OPTIONS
- ຈໍສະແດງຜົນ
ຕິດຕາມດ້ວຍຈໍສະແດງຜົນເພື່ອເປີດ.
-sync ເຮັດໃຫ້ການຮ້ອງຂໍ X ທັງຫມົດຖືກປະຕິບັດ synchronously.
- ຊັບສິນ
ເຮັດໃຫ້ຄຸນສົມບັດທີ່ລະບຸໄວ້ຖືກໃຊ້ແທນຊື່ windows (ເຊິ່ງແມ່ນ
WM_NAME). ບາງຄ່າທີ່ເປັນໄປໄດ້ແມ່ນ: WM_CLASS, WM_COMMAND, WM_ICON_NAME,
WM_CLIENT_MACHINE.
-pop ແມ່ນການປະຕິບັດໃນຕອນຕົ້ນ. ມັນຈໍາເປັນຕ້ອງໃຫ້ພຽງແຕ່ຖ້າມັນຕ້ອງການເຊັ່ນດຽວກັນກັບບາງອັນ
function
-focus ຈະໃຫ້ຈຸດສຸມການປ້ອນຂໍ້ມູນກັບປ່ອງຢ້ຽມທີ່ກໍານົດໄວ້.
-iconify
ຈະ iconify windows ແທນທີ່ຈະ popping ເຂົາເຈົ້າ.
-unmap ຈະ iconify windows ໂດຍ unmapping ກັບຕົວຈັດການປ່ອງຢ້ຽມທີ່ບໍ່ປະຕິບັດຕາມ ICCCM.
(ລະວັງ, ທາງເລືອກນີ້ບໍ່ແມ່ນສິ່ງທີ່ທ່ານຕ້ອງການ).
- ຍົກສູງບົດບາດປ່ອງຢ້ຽມ (ແຕ່ຢ່າເຮັດແຜນທີ່ພວກມັນຖ້າບໍ່ມີແຜນທີ່).
- ປ່ອງຢ້ຽມຕ່ໍາຕ່ໍາ.
- ກົງກັນຂ້າມ
ສະຫຼັບການວາງໜ້າຕ່າງຈາກເທິງລົງລຸ່ມລະຫວ່າງໜ້າຕ່າງທີ່ທັບຊ້ອນກັນ.
- ໝູນວຽນ
ໝູນວຽນໜ້າຈໍຍ່ອຍຂອງໜ້າຕ່າງໄປຂ້າງໜ້າ. ໃຊ້ນີ້ກັບ -root.
- uncirculate
ໝູນວຽນໜ້າຈໍຍ່ອຍຂອງໜ້າຕ່າງກັບຫຼັງ. ໃຊ້ນີ້ກັບ -root.
-ປັບຂະຫນາດ wh
ປັບຂະໜາດໜ້າຕ່າງເປັນຂະໜາດ pixels ລວງທີ່ໃຫ້.
- ແຖວ r
ປັບຂະໜາດໜ້າຕ່າງເປັນຈຳນວນແຖວທີ່ໃຫ້ໄວ້.
- ຖັນ ຄ
ປັບຂະໜາດໜ້າຕ່າງເປັນຈຳນວນຖັນທີ່ກຳນົດໄວ້.
- ຍ້າຍ xy
ຍ້າຍປ່ອງຢ້ຽມໄປຫາຕໍາແຫນ່ງຢ່າງແທ້ຈິງທີ່ກ່ຽວຂ້ອງກັບພໍ່ແມ່ຂອງມັນ. (ຖ້າ x ຫຼື y
ຄ່າແມ່ນເປັນລົບ, ມັນໄດ້ຖືກປະຕິບັດກັບຂອບຂວາຫຼືລຸ່ມຂອງພໍ່ແມ່.)
-rmve xy
ຍ້າຍປ່ອງຢ້ຽມໂດຍປະລິມານທີ່ໃຫ້.
-warp xy
ຍ້າຍຕົວກະພິບໄປຫາຕໍາແຫນ່ງທີ່ໃຫ້ທຽບກັບປ່ອງຢ້ຽມທີ່ລະບຸ. ເພີ່ມຮາກ
ເພື່ອ warp ກັບຕໍາແຫນ່ງຢ່າງແທ້ຈິງ.
-rwarp xy
ຍ້າຍຕົວກະພິບຕາມຈຳນວນທີ່ໃຫ້ມາ.
-colormap colormapid
ຕິດຕັ້ງແຜນຜັງສີໃສ່ໃນປ່ອງຢ້ຽມທີ່ໃຫ້. -save -nosave ທັນທີເປີດໃຊ້
ຫຼືປິດການໃຊ້ງານຕົວຮັກສາໜ້າຈໍ.
- ຊື່
ຕັ້ງຄຸນສົມບັດ WM_NAME ໃຫ້ກັບສະຕຣິງທີ່ໃຫ້ໄວ້.
- ຊື່ icon
ຕັ້ງຄ່າຄຸນສົມບັດ WM_ICON_NAME ເປັນສະຕຣິງທີ່ໃຫ້ໄວ້.
- ໄຟລ໌ bitmap
ໃຊ້ໄຟລ໌ bitmap ທີ່ເປັນ icon bitmap ສໍາລັບປ່ອງຢ້ຽມ.
- ໄຟລ໌ຫນ້າກາກ
ໃຊ້ໄຟລ໌ bitmap ທີ່ເປັນຮູບສັນຍາລັກຫນ້າກາກສໍາລັບປ່ອງຢ້ຽມ.
-iconmove xy
ຍ້າຍໄອຄອນໄປທີ່ຕຳແໜ່ງທີ່ແນ່ນອນ. (ຈະບໍ່ເຮັດວຽກກັບບາງປ່ອງຢ້ຽມ
ຜູ້ຈັດການ.)
-riconmove xy
ຍ້າຍໄອຄອນຕາມຈຳນວນທີ່ໃຫ້ມາ. (ຈະບໍ່ເຮັດວຽກກັບບາງປ່ອງຢ້ຽມ
ຜູ້ຈັດການ.)
-backingstore -bs -nobackingstore -nobs
ເປີດຫຼືປິດການເກັບຮັກສາ backing ສໍາລັບປ່ອງຢ້ຽມ.
-saveunder -su -nosaveunder -nosu
ເປີດຫຼືປິດການທໍາງານ saveunders ສໍາລັບປ່ອງຢ້ຽມ.
-keyrepeat -nokeyrepeat
ແມ່ນຕິດຕາມດ້ວຍບັນຊີລາຍຊື່ຂອງລະຫັດ (ຕົວເລກທົດສະນິຍົມ, ເບິ່ງ xmodmap(1)). ຂອບເຂດສາມາດ
ຖືກລະບຸເປັນຕົວເລກຕ່ໍາ, ``-'', ແລະຕົວເລກເທິງເປັນສາມແຍກ
ການໂຕ້ຖຽງ. ການຕັ້ງຄ່າສ່ວນບຸກຄົນຂອງການຊໍ້າຄືນອັດຕະໂນມັດສໍາລັບລະຫັດລະຫັດເຫຼົ່ານັ້ນແມ່ນຖືກຕັ້ງໄວ້ຫຼື
ປິດ. ການຕັ້ງຄ່າທົ່ວໂລກຂອງການເຮັດຊ້ຳອັດຕະໂນມັດສາມາດຖືກຕັ້ງຄ່າດ້ວຍ xset(1). ເມື່ອປິດ, ບໍ່ມີກະແຈ
ຈະເຮັດຊ້ຳ.
-print ຈະພິມ id, ປະສານງານ, ຄວາມເລິກແລະຊື່ຂອງປ່ອງຢ້ຽມທີ່ເລືອກທັງຫມົດ.
ຖ້າ -property ຖືກມອບໃຫ້, ອັນນັ້ນຈະຖືກພິມແທນຊື່.
ການເລືອກປ່ອງຢ້ຽມ
ຖ້າບໍ່ມີປ່ອງຢ້ຽມຖືກລະບຸ, $WINDOWID ຈະຖືກໃຊ້ຖ້າຕັ້ງ; ຖ້າບໍ່ດັ່ງນັ້ນປ່ອງຢ້ຽມ
ພາຍໃຕ້ຕົວກະພິບຈະຖືກເລືອກ.
-id ແມ່ນຕິດຕາມດ້ວຍຕົວເລກປ່ອງຢ້ຽມດຽວ, ໃນອັດຕານິຍົມ; ຫຼື, ຖ້າມັນເລີ່ມຕົ້ນດ້ວຍ 0x, in
ເລກຖານສິບຫົກ
-root ເລືອກ window ຮາກ.
- ປະຈຸບັນ
ເລືອກປ່ອງຢ້ຽມພາຍໃຕ້ຕົວກະພິບ (ຄ່າເລີ່ມຕົ້ນຖ້າບໍ່ມີປ່ອງຢ້ຽມທີ່ລະບຸໄວ້ແລະ $WINDOWID
ບໍ່ໄດ້ກໍານົດ).
- ເລືອກ
ອະນຸຍາດໃຫ້ຜູ້ໃຊ້ສາມາດໂຕ້ຕອບເລືອກປ່ອງຢ້ຽມດ້ວຍຫນູໄດ້.
-all ແມ່ນທຽບເທົ່າກັບ -names '', ເປັນງ່າຍທີ່ຈະຈື່ຈໍາ.
-names ຖ້າຫາກວ່າໃຫ້ຕ້ອງເປັນທາງເລືອກສຸດທ້າຍແລະປະຕິບັດຕາມໂດຍບັນຊີລາຍຊື່ຂອງສະຕຣິງ. ປ່ອງຢ້ຽມທັງຫມົດ
ທີ່ມີຊື່ທີ່ເລີ່ມຕົ້ນຄ້າຍຄືຫນຶ່ງຂອງສະຕຣິງຈະໄດ້ຮັບການປະຕິບັດຕາມ.
ຖ້າ -property ຖືກມອບໃຫ້, ຊັບສິນນີ້ຖືກນໍາໃຊ້ແທນຊື່. ໂດຍໃຊ້ null
string (-names ''), ຊື່ທັງຫມົດຈະຖືກຈັບຄູ່.
ຕົວຢ່າງ
ເພື່ອ de-iconify ແລະ pop ``ນີ້'' xterm ແລະ warp ຕົວກະພິບເຂົ້າໄປໃນມັນ:
xwit -pop -warp 50 50
ເພື່ອໂຕ້ຕອບເລືອກ xterm, ແລະປັບຂະຫນາດມັນເປັນ 34 ແຖວແລະ 80 ຖັນ:
xwit -ເລືອກ -rows 34 -columns 80
ເພື່ອກະຕຸ້ນໂມງຂອງເຈົ້າຢູ່ໜ້າຈໍເບົາໆ:
ໃນຂະນະທີ່ xwit -rmove 0 10 -names oclock
do xwit -rmove 0 -10 -names ໂມງ
ເຮັດ
ທິດສະດີວິທະຍາ
ສະຖານະການອອກຈາກແມ່ນ 0 ຖ້າການດໍາເນີນການໃດໆ, 1 ຖ້າບໍ່ມີປ່ອງຢ້ຽມກົງກັບລາຍຊື່ທີ່ສະຫນອງໃຫ້
-names, 2 ຖ້າຫາກວ່າຄວາມຜິດພາດເກີດຂຶ້ນ.
ຂອບເຂດ ຈຳ ກັດ
ເນື່ອງຈາກວ່າແຕ່ລະຄໍາຮ້ອງສະຫມັກແມ່ນ supposed ຮ້ອງຂໍການທໍາງານເຫຼົ່ານີ້ຂອງຜູ້ຈັດການປ່ອງຢ້ຽມ, ບາງ
ຂອງພວກເຂົາອາດຈະບໍ່ມັກລູກຄ້າອື່ນທີ່ເຮັດແຜນທີ່ແລະ unmapping ໃຫ້ເຂົາເຈົ້າຢູ່ຫລັງຂອງພວກເຂົາ.
Iconification ແມ່ນຮ້ອງຂໍໃຫ້ຜູ້ຈັດການປ່ອງຢ້ຽມໂດຍໃຊ້ ICCCM. ບໍ່ປະຕິບັດຕາມ ICCCM
ຜູ້ຈັດການປ່ອງຢ້ຽມອາດຈະບໍ່ຕອບສະຫນອງຢ່າງຖືກຕ້ອງ.
AUTHORS
Mark M Martin, CETIA France, [email protected]
David DiGiacomo, [email protected]
ການຍອມຮັບ
ຂອບໃຈ Andre Delafontaine, Norman R. McBride, Keith Thompson, Glen R. Walker, Michael
Mauch, Dima Barsky ແລະ Decklin ອຸປະຖໍາສໍາລັບການລາຍງານ bug, ຄໍາແນະນໍາແລະ / ຫຼື patches.
2 Dec 2005 XWIT(1)
ໃຊ້ xwit ອອນໄລນ໌ໂດຍໃຊ້ບໍລິການ onworks.net